Two Egyptian Geese (Alopochen aegyptiaca) are observed walking on a paved pathway within a landscaped garden or public park area in the city of Monaco, Monaco. The goose in the foreground, positioned centrally, faces right and is captured mid-stride with its left leg raised, displaying its characteristic brown, tan, and grey plumage, along with a distinct dark brown patch around its eye. A second goose is visible further back and to the right, walking away from the camera on the same path. The pathway features sections of reddish-brown textured paving adjacent to grey paving, with a dark metal drainage grate running along a division line. To the immediate left of the path, a strip of manicured green grass is present. The background consists of dense, varied foliage, including shrubs with green and reddish-brown leaves, and larger tropical plants such as palm trees and broad-leafed species. A wooden slatted fence or wall structure is partially visible in the upper left background. The scene is brightly illuminated by natural sunlight, casting clear shadows.
